Yoona was busy walking with a huge stack of folders in her arms, which were constantly threatening to fall. Her homeroom teacher had asked her to bring the folders to the file room which was on the third floor. She sighed as she climbed the staircase and cursed herself. She knew her teacher could’ve done it by herself, yet she also knew that today Ms. Kwon was going on a date with a hot guy she just met. She couldn’t have said no when her teacher was desperately begging her.

 

Upon reaching the third floor, Yoona cursed again. She would have to walk to the end of this impossibly long hallway before she could reach the file room, where most of the records were stored. She had a quick battle with her mind if she would continue or not. But, there was no other choice now. She already made it this far. She sighed in defeat and continued walking.

 

When she reached the area in front of the first room to her right, a door was suddenly pushed open; hitting Yoona’s extended arms carrying the folders. In shock, she fell backwards to the floor on her and dropped the folders, scattering its contents around. Yoona was rubbing her aching behind when a figure gloomed before her. She looked up to see a guy standing in front of her.

 

Yoona’s senses stopped right there and then. Her jaw dropped and suddenly she lost her ability to speak. How could it not? The guy in front of her was superbly, incredibly good-looking. He was tall and had very minimal muscles, as what she could see behind the roughly fitting blazer he wore over their standard school uniform. He had a very amiable aura surrounding him. Even with his height and build, Yoona did not fear him.

 

But what caught Yoona’s eyes (and made her choke on her own saliva) were the things above his neck. The guy had breathtaking features. He had pale skin that can match a vampire’s. A high nose that complimented his face, slightly chubby cheeks (Yoona had the urge to pinch them), pink, plump, perfectly-shaped lips that made Yoona want to kiss them, and deep brown orbs staring at her through shined lenses outlined by sleek plastic and metal brown frame were splayed on his face, each feature accentuating each other and matching perfectly on his face. What a looker. This guy was perfection.

 

As though oblivious to her stare that could’ve burned holes in his face if it could, the guy dropped to his knees and held her arms, worry and a hint of guilt strewn across his face. Yoona watched those eyes travel over her and around her, where the folders were lying. Upon seeing the mess he made, he bit his lower lip, and Yoona swore she could’ve died at the sight.

 

He turned back to her and spoke apologizing words, to which Yoona could only mutter incoherent responses. Even his voice had made an impact to her. Deep and harmonious, Yoona could imagine herself waking up to this voice. Wait. What?! What am I thinking? She thought to herself. Surely she was-if not obviously-totally smitten by this guy who she met mere minutes ago.

 

Kyuhyun. Cho Kyuhyun. He said his name was. Yoona said the word on her lips like it was meant to be. She said his name a few more times in her head and swore to herself she would never forget. He helped her to her feet as gently as he could while asking a few more questions about Yoona’s condition, to which Yoona gave a short, very general reply, in contrast to her screaming in her mind that she couldn’t be possibly hurting anymore-not when this heavenly guy had come to her aid. He smiled at her and began to pick up the pieces of papers scattered around. All the while Yoona stared at him, but was suddenly jerked back to her senses when he half of what she originally carried in her hands.

 

She looked at him as he picked up the remaining pieces and asked her where the folders were supposed to be carried to. Yoona politely refused, seeing that there was no need for her to bother this extremely gorgeous guy in glasses to help her with her job. He insisted though, and brought about a pleading expression Yoona couldn’t say no to. She nodded and gestured for him to follow.

 

Yoona walked ahead, making sure that Kyuhyun couldn’t see the blush that crept up her cheeks as they walked towards the file room. All the way to their destination, Kyuhyun talked and told her interesting little stories. Apparently, he was only a year older than Yoona, when all the while she thought was he was already graduating. I guess a have a lot of time to get to know him better, she thought, a smile never leaving her face as they continued. When they had reached the file room and had put the folders in the bin with Ms. Kwon’s name on it, Yoona brushed off his apologies, saying nothing was intentional and thanked him for his help.

 

She was about to walk away when Kyuhyun suddenly grabbed her wrist, making her heart pound harder than it usually did. He smiled-a deadly one (to which Yoona’s heart responded by beating faster) -before releasing her wrist and telling her to head down carefully and avoid getting hit by doors along the way. Yoona laughed her alligator laugh loudly, forgetting that this handsome young man was watching her.

 

“You’re really beautiful.”

 

Yoona instantly stopped laughing and turned her head to him. She could’ve sworn that the words he had just said were all in her head, but the expression on his face said otherwise. She bowed her head in embarrassment, feeling her cheeks warm at his statement. He called her, saying her name in the sweetest way, but Yoona was far too absorbed in her thoughts to notice him. When she felt him getting closer to her, she immediately bowed and muttered a soft good-bye before walking fast down the hallway, her heart about to explode out of her chest. This infatuation was going to be the end of her.

 

When she reached the bench near her locker, she stopped to rest. She had been running away from him since she got out of his sight. She couldn’t show him how red her cheeks were right now. That will only embarrass her more. Unfortunately, the last person she wanted to see at the moment suddenly appeared next to her, surprising her greatly. He was bending down and huffing. Clearly he had been running after her, making Yoona blush more at the thought.

 

She gulped nervously as she watched him catch his breath. He seemed to be really exhausted, she thought. Politely, she offered him to sit so that he could rest for a while, at the same time scolding herself for diving in to the temptation of getting him close to her. She held her breath as he complied and sat a little too close to her, bending his head back to rest on the wall behind the bench. Yoona gulped  and pointedly looked away. After all, seeing his sweat running down his face and bare neck and seeing him fix his glasses in a totally cool way made Yoona flush even more. She knew she would at least look like a cherry tomato at the time.

 

Neither of them said anything for a while. Kyuhyun was still resting himself and Yoona was still staring at the floor, begging her heart to stop pounding for Kyuhyun might hear. Sometime later, a few seconds or minutes-Yoona didn’t really count-Kyuhyun sat properly and fixed his misplaced uniform, taking out his handkerchief to wipe his sweat (Yoona still wasn’t looking).

 

“You run really fast for a girl.”

 

Yoona instantly turned to him, her hands clenching her skirt tightly as he chuckled at her confused expression. Was that a compliment? Swallowing her embarrassment and praying her voice wouldn’t crack, she asked him why he ran after her. He answered that he was afraid she’d trip or fall because she was running so fast. Yoona chuckled lightly, telling him she was used to it and he didn’t need to worry. Kyuhyun laughed heartily at her response, saying how boyish she was, which earned him a shy scoff from the girl. They stayed in silence for a few moments, each enjoying the feeling of fresh air blowing through the doors and the serenity sitting next to each other.

 

“Well, seeing that you’re safe, I’ll go ahead.”

 

Yoona looked at him stand up and did the same, muttering a string of thanks and apologies. He smiled widely at her before bowing down and turning to walk away. Yoona watched his retreating figure with a happy thought lingering. A few meters away, Kyuhyun stopped walking. Yoona’s face scrunched up in confusion but in a snap she was blushing again as Kyuhyun said the few words she had been longing to hear from him since earlier.

 

“I hope to meet you again. I think I will though. Keep safe.”

 

She froze in her place, lips slightly gaping and eyes sparkling at what he had just said. Kyuhyun took a long glance at her before giving her another of his lethal smiles again, seemingly amused at Yoona’s reaction to him. He waved at her and turned to leave, whistling a happy tune as he walked. Yoona, in return, only managed to do a small wave at him before flopping down on the bench, clutching her chest in an attempt to keep her heart there. She had experienced too many heart-wrenching moments just meeting Kyuhyun today. She wondered if she can still keep up.

 

But she was overjoyed. Never had she been this giddy from meeting someone before. Maybe he was someone special given to her by God. She wasn’t sure, but meeting Kyuhyun had become a turning point in her life. She didn’t exactly know what was in store, but she was ecstatic about it.

 

I hope to meet you again. He had said. The thought of seeing his beautiful smile and hearing him talk in that deep voice of his had sent her pulse racing again. When can they meet again? Probably tomorrow, or the next day, or maybe next week; she didn’t really mind. All she knew was that she was looking forward to seeing him again.
